Supreme Court of Colorado
County of Boulder v. Boulder and Weld County Ditch Co
March 21, 20162016 CO 17
Summary
The court affirmed dismissal of Boulder County’s application because the County failed to prove the historical consumptive use of the water right it sought to change. The County’s analysis did not reliably quantify historical deliveries or establish that the claimed acreage had actually been irrigated with the relevant portion of the water right, preventing the County from proving that the change would not injure other water users. Because the change was denied, the related exchange and augmentation-plan requests also failed.
